Description: Kelly & Co. engraved by F. Bryer, c.1889. In 1883 Kelly and Co. introduced a new map for their Directory of Devonshire and Cornwall to replace the earlier Becker map of 1856. This map was printed by the Cheffins company at their Steam Printing Works and the engraver employed was F. Bryer. By this time Kelly's address was Gt Queen Street, London, where they had moved in 1870. Although many copies of the directory exist, unfortunately most have lost their maps. This map continued to be used in the Directory of Devonshire up to 1939.
